ReactOS (a free windows alternative / replacement) supports installing and booting off of two file systems. FAT32 and BTRFS. General Use Installing ReactOS onto either FAT32 or BTRFS is the same process, booting the installer and selecting what you want to format your partition as, then installing the OS.
